Mountain biking around Kühsen offers diverse terrain shaped by the Vistula Ice Age, featuring a hilly landscape dotted with lakes and extensive forests. The region provides varied gradients suitable for off-road cycling, from gentle paths to moderate climbs. Riders can explore picturesque woodlands, scenic routes along the Elbe-Lübeck Canal, and paths bordering Lake Ratzeburg. This combination of natural features makes Kühsen an appealing destination for mountain bikers seeking both beauty and varied challenges.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are there in Kühsen?

Kühsen offers a wide selection of mountain bike trails, with over 210 routes available. These range from easy rides to more challenging options, ensuring there's something for every skill level.

What is the terrain like for mountain biking around Kühsen?

The terrain around Kühsen is characterized by a hilly landscape, shaped by the Vistula Ice Age, offering varied gradients suitable for off-road cycling. You'll find extensive forests, paths along the Elbe-Lübeck Canal, and scenic routes bordering Lake Ratzeburg, providing a mix of natural beauty and moderate challenges.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Kühsen?

Yes, Kühsen has plenty of options for beginners. Out of the over 210 trails, 77 are classified as easy. These routes typically feature gentler inclines and less technical sections, making them ideal for those new to mountain biking or looking for a relaxed ride. An example of an easy route is the Schulsee Mölln loop from Niendorf bei Berkenthin.

What natural features or landmarks can I see while mountain biking in Kühsen?

Many mountain bike routes in Kühsen pass by beautiful natural features and landmarks. You can explore the shores of Ratzeburg Lake, enjoy views of the lake and Ratzeburg Cathedral, or cycle through the historic Ratzeburg — Island Town. The region also features picturesque forests and the tranquil Karpfenkuhle lake.

What do other mountain bikers enjoy about the trails in Kühsen?

The mountain bike trails in Kühsen are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.7 stars from over 500 reviews. Riders often praise the diverse terrain, the scenic beauty of the forests and lakes, and the well-maintained paths that offer a rewarding experience for various skill levels.

Are there family-friendly mountain bike trails in Kühsen?

Yes, Kühsen offers several family-friendly mountain bike trails. Many of the easy routes are suitable for families, providing enjoyable rides through scenic landscapes without overly technical sections. The region's extensive network of forest paths and lakeside trails often includes options that are perfect for a family outing.

Are there circular mountain bike routes available in Kühsen?

Absolutely. Many of the mountain bike trails around Kühsen are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end your ride in the same location. Examples include the popular Elbe–Lübeck Canal Path – Berkenthin Lock loop from Behlendorf and the Singletrack in the forest – Kühsen Bathing Area loop from Nusse.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Kühsen?

The best time for mountain biking in Kühsen is generally from spring through autumn. During these seasons, the weather is typically mild, and the trails are in good condition. Spring offers blooming canola fields around Karpfenkuhle, while autumn provides beautiful foliage in the extensive forests. Winter riding is possible, but trail conditions can vary with snow and ice.

Can I bring my dog on the mountain bike trails in Kühsen?

While there isn't specific data on dog-friendly trails, many natural areas in Germany allow dogs on trails, often requiring them to be on a leash. It's always best to check local signage or specific route descriptions on komoot for any restrictions before heading out with your dog.

Where can I park my car when mountain biking in Kühsen?

Parking is generally available in and around Kühsen, particularly near popular trailheads or village centers. Many routes start from locations like Behlendorf or Nusse, which typically offer parking facilities. It's advisable to check the starting point of your chosen route on komoot for specific parking information.

Are there any challenging mountain bike trails in Kühsen?

While Kühsen is not known for extreme technical trails, it does offer moderately challenging routes. Out of the over 210 trails, 132 are rated as moderate, and there is at least one difficult trail. These routes feature more significant elevation changes and potentially more demanding terrain, such as the Ratzeburg Lake – Swimming spot by the lake loop from Behlendorf, which has over 270 meters of ascent.

Are there mountain bike trails accessible by public transport in Kühsen?

Kühsen and the surrounding villages are connected by local bus services, which can provide access to various starting points for mountain bike trails. While direct public transport access to every trailhead might be limited, planning your route to start near a bus stop can make it accessible without a car. Always check current timetables and bike transport policies for local public transport.
